    Why an 82-year-old woman joined the NDC’s Victory Walk

    On Saturday, January 4, 2025, Aggie, an 82-year-old woman, captured the hearts of many when she joined the National Democratic Congress‘ (NDC) Victory Walk to celebrate the party’s decisive win in the 2024 general elections.

    The atmosphere was filled with celebration and anticipation, as NDC supporters looked forward to a new chapter in Ghana’s political history.

    In an interview with GhanaWeb TV, Aggie shared her reasons for participating in the event.

    She expressed optimism that President-elect John Dramani Mahama would lead the country toward recovery and prosperity.

    “I have lived long enough to know the difference. The Akufo-Addo-led government completely exhausted Ghanaians, leaving many in despair. That is why I joined the Victory Walk. I believe John Dramani Mahama will reset the country and restore hope,” she said.

    The Victory Walk set the tone for the inauguration and swearing-in ceremony of President-elect John Dramani Mahama and Vice President-elect Prof. Naana Jane Opoku-Agyemang, scheduled for January 7, 2025, at the Black Star Square.
